Sourcing Peyote Cactus Seeds: Legality and Best Practices
Acquiring obtaining peyote cactus seeds is a challenging endeavor, largely due to significant legal limitations globally and in the United States. It's crucial to understand that peyote, *Lophophora williamsii*, is a protected plant and its cultivation is generally prohibited outside of specific, permitted religious practices – primarily within the Native American Church (NAC). Attempting to purchase or nurture peyote seeds without proper authorization can result in substantial legal penalties , including fines and likely imprisonment. While some online sellers may advertise seeds, their validity is often questionable, and the seeds are frequently misidentified varieties of other cacti. Thus, proceed with extreme caution and thorough research. If you are a member of the NAC and seeking seeds for ceremonial purposes, reaching out to your tribal authorities and obtaining guidance from experienced elders is absolutely vital . Peyote Cactus for Sale: Knowing the Limitations
Finding peyote cacti for sale online or locally can be tempting, but it's vitally important to recognize the complex legal framework surrounding their acquisition. United States laws and local statutes heavily restrict the growing and handling of this protected plant. In essence, while specific Native American tribes are allowed exemptions for religious practices, general individuals often face serious penalties, such as fines and imprisonment sentences, for unlawfully obtaining or holding peyote without the necessary authorization. Therefore, thorough investigation is absolutely necessary before even contemplating any transaction.
